:root{font-family:system-ui,Avenir,Helvetica,Arial,sans-serif;line-height:1.5;font-weight:400;font-synthesis:none;text-rendering:optimizeLeg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;color-scheme:light dark;--color-bg: #242424;--color-text: rgba(255, 255, 255, .87);--color-text-muted: #888;--button-bg: #1a1a1a;--button-hover-border: #646cff;--button-disabled-opacity: .5;--link-color: #646cff;--link-hover-color: #535bf2;--input-bg-color: #1a1a1a;--input-text-color: #efefef;--input-border-color: #555;--pdf-container-bg: #2d2d2d;--pdf-container-border: #333;--pdf-loading-bg: rgba(45, 45, 45, .9);--pdf-loading-text: #efefef;--loader-border: #333;--loader-accent: #3498db}a{font-weight:500;color:var(--link-color);text-decoration:inherit}a:hover{color:var(--link-hover-color)}body{margin:0;display:flex;place-items:center;min-width:320px;min-height:100vh;overflow-x:hidden;background-color:var(--color-bg);color:var(--color-text)}h1{font-size:3.2em;line-height:1.1}#app{max-width:1280px;margin:0 auto;padding:2rem;text-align:center}.logo{height:6em;padding:1.5em;will-change:filter;transition:filter .3s}.logo:hover{filter:drop-shadow(0 0 2em #646cffaa)}.logo.vanilla:hover{filter:drop-shadow(0 0 2em #3178c6aa)}.card{padding:2em}.read-the-docs{color:var(--color-text-muted)}button{border-radius:8px;border:1px solid transparent;padding:.6em 1.2em;font-size:1em;font-weight:500;font-family:inherit;background-color:var(--button-bg);color:var(--color-text);cursor:pointer;transition:border-color .25s,opacity .25s}button:hover:not(:disabled){border-color:var(--button-hover-border)}button:focus,button:focus-visible{outline:4px auto -webkit-focus-ring-color}button:disabled{opacity:var(--button-disabled-opacity);cursor:not-allowed}#main{margin:auto;width:100%;max-width:1200px;display:flex;flex-direction:column;align-items:center}#pdf-viewer-container{width:100%;height:70vh;margin:20px 0;display:flex;justify-content:center;align-items:center}#pdf-container{width:100%;height:100%;max-width:95vw;display:flex;justify-content:center;align-items:center;position:relative;overflow:hidden;background-color:var(--pdf-container-bg);border:1px solid var(--pdf-container-border);border-radius:4px}#pdf-canvas{max-width:100%;max-height:100%;object-fit:contain}#pdf-loading{position:absolute;top:0;left:0;width:100%;height:100%;display:flex;flex-direction:column;justify-content:center;align-items:center;background-color:var(--pdf-loading-bg);color:var(--pdf-loading-text);z-index:10}.loader{border:5px solid var(--loader-border);border-top:5px solid var(--loader-accent);border-radius:50%;width:40px;height:40px;animation:spin 1s linear infinite;margin-bottom:15px}@keyframes spin{0%{transform:rotate(0)}to{transform:rotate(360deg)}}#page-info{font-size:14px;min-width:100px;text-align:center;color:var(--color-text)}#page-input,#export-quality{padding:5px 8px;border-radius:4px;border:1px solid var(--input-border-color);font-size:14px;background-color:var(--input-bg-color);color:var(--input-text-color)}#page-input:disabled,#export-quality:disabled{opacity:var(--button-disabled-opacity);cursor:not-allowed}#export-canvas{position:absolute;left:-9999px;visibility:hidden}@media (prefers-color-scheme: light){:root{--color-bg: #ffffff;--color-text: #213547;--color-text-muted: #666;--button-bg: #f9f9f9;--button-hover-border: #747bff;--link-color: #646cff;--link-hover-color: #747bff;--input-bg-color: #ffffff;--input-text-color: #213547;--input-border-color: #ccc;--pdf-container-bg: #f5f5f5;--pdf-container-border: #ddd;--pdf-loading-bg: rgba(245, 245, 245, .9);--pdf-loading-text: #333;--loader-border: #f3f3f3;--loader-accent: #3498db}}
